Read More“Match Made in Heaven”: PF Partnership Enables Parishioner Payments
The Church of England is going cashless with the help of PFs iZettle and SumUp.
The church announced this week that a partnership with the two companies would enable churches across England to accept cashless payments for events, church and hall bookings, and one-off donations.
